Core Durability Evaluation Criteria for Accessory Materials
Durability testing checks if a material can keep its look and work well over time. First up is appearance retention. A good accessory holds its color and texture even after many uses and washes. For example, when you feel a fabric bag, run your fingers over it to spot any bumps or rough areas that might be signs of wear.
Next, test the material's strength during everyday use. In simple terms, see how it handles regular stress. Look for loose seams, weak stitching, or hardware that feels like it might come off. A quick tug on a seam or a small pull on an attachment point can tell you if it will stand up to daily use.
Finish stability is also very important. The finish (like a coating or chemical treatment, which is a layer that protects the material) helps ward off wear during cleaning. If this finish is applied poorly, it might fade or peel after repeated washes. Checking the finish as the material goes from raw fabric to a finished accessory can suggest how well it will hold up in real life.
Keep these checks in mind, appearance retention, strength under stress, and finish stability. They offer a simple checklist to help you decide if an accessory is built to last.
Accessory Material Strength Comparison: Leather, Metal, Fabric, and Synthetics

When choosing accessory materials, it's best to compare what each one does best. Full-grain leather, for example, is tough and can handle a lot of stress (tensile strength means how much force it can take without tearing) while resisting scratches. This makes it a smart pick for luxury bags and wallets that need to last.
Stainless steel is another strong option. It supports heavy loads and fights off rust well, keeping its shine for a long time. However, gold plating tends to wear off after heavy use, so it may not be the best choice if you need extra durability.
Ballistic nylon is made to handle heavy wear and can carry a lot, which is great for backpacks and straps. Canvas is also reliable for everyday use, though it is not as tough if you push it too hard. Polymer composites mix good strength with being light, making them a solid option for sports accessories or items used in active settings.
Below is a table that breaks down each material's scratch resistance, corrosion resistance, and how best to use them. This guide helps you figure out which material fits your needs for strength and long-term wear.
| Material | Durability Metrics | Scratch Resistance | Corrosion Resistance | Recommended Use |
|---|---|---|---|---|
| Full-Grain Leather | High tensile, low abrasion | Very High | Moderate | Luxury bags, wallets |
| Stainless Steel | High load-bearing | High | Very High | Watches, hardware |
| Ballistic Nylon | High abrasion | Moderate | High | Backpacks, straps |
| Gold Plating | Low abrasion | Low | Moderate | Jewelry, accents |
| Polymer Composite | Balanced strength | High | High | Sport accessories |
By checking these details, you can easily decide which material matches your style and how hard you plan to use it.
Expert-Recommended Testing Methods for Accessory Durability
Experts check the quality of materials by running tests that copy everyday wear. They use simple tests to see how items perform under regular rubbing and bending. One common tool is the Martindale abrasion tester (a device that rubs the fabric many times). This machine, which celebrated 80 years in 2022, works alongside well-maintained equipment, reliable test materials, and skilled technicians.
These tests usually happen in a controlled lab where experts can measure how long an accessory lasts and how much stress it can handle. Real-life tests also take place to see how items, like protective gear and bright accessories, hold up under tougher conditions.
Another important check is seeing how the material deals with repeated bending and flexing. Running the fabric through many cycles shows whether it can last for a long time without breaking down.
The finish on an accessory is also put to the test. Experts look at how coatings or chemical treatments stand up to repeated washes. For metal parts, tests for corrosion ensure that both the look and function stay intact over time.
Standard testing methods include:
- Martindale abrasion (cycles until failure)
- Tensile strength (maximum load capacity)
- Cyclic flexing (resistance to repeated bending)
- Colorfastness wash test (durability of the finish)
- Salt spray corrosion (resistance to rust)
Accessory Durability: How to Judge Quality Materials Smart

When you check an accessory, start by looking closely at the stitching. Count around 10 stitches per inch on seams that hold a lot of weight. Run your finger along the seam and feel for smooth, even stitches. If it feels rough or loose, that might be a sign of future problems.
Next, look at the finished edges. Good edge work stops the fabric from fraying and helps keep moisture away. Gently tug a bit on the edge. If it holds firm, the finish was likely done well.
Also, inspect the hardware like buckles and zippers. These parts need to handle a lot, so they should be sturdy and free from rust or signs of wear. A quick look for any corrosion can tell you if they’re built to last.
Lastly, press gently on the lining. A strong accessory will have a lining that feels solid and evenly supported, which helps it keep its shape over time.
Using simple touch and visual checks like these can help you decide if an accessory is built to stick around.
Industry Standards and Certification for Accessory Material Durability
Checking for quality marks on accessories can help you know that they have been tested and meet set standards. For instance, ISO 12947 tests how much rubbing a fabric can handle, so when you see that mark, you know the material has been put through real wear and tear. ASTM D5034, which checks if the fabric can handle being pulled without tearing, is another important label. Accessories with the ISO 105-X12 mark have been checked to see if they keep their color even after many washes.
For metal parts, look for ASTM B117. This tells you the metal has been tested to resist salt spray and hold up in harsh conditions. And if you see EN 388 on protective linings, it means the item has passed strong mechanical tests for everyday use.
Before you buy, take a moment to look for these marks. They show that the accessory has passed strict tests, which gives you confidence in its long-term durability.
Maintenance and Wear-Resistance Tips to Prolong Accessory Lifecycle

Keep your accessories looking fresh with some simple habits. For leather items, start with a pH-neutral cleaner that is gentle on the material. Follow up every six months by using a bit of wax or oil to restore water resistance and keep the leather soft. For fabric pieces, use a mild soap that cleans well without stripping away essential fibers, so the texture and color stay vibrant.
Metal accessories need a little extra care. Store them in places where the air is dry to cut down on moisture, and use an anti-corrosion spray to help prevent rust. This keeps them shiny and strong over time.
Rotating your accessories can also lengthen their lifespan. Instead of using your favorite bag or watch every day, give them a break so they don’t wear out too quickly. And if you spend time in strong sunlight, try to keep your accessories out of the direct rays. UV light can fade colors and weaken materials.
Remember these simple tips:
- Clean leather with a pH-neutral cleaner and condition it every six months.
- Use mild soap to wash fabrics.
- Store metal items in dry areas and use an anti-corrosion spray.
- Rotate your accessories regularly.
- Keep them out of direct sunlight to maintain colors and strength.
Sustainable Materials and Robust Design Strategies for Lasting Accessories
Vegetable-tanned leather is a smart choice because it uses fewer chemicals and gets better with time. When this leather ages, it develops a rich tone that tells its story of durability.
Recycled polyester and nylon blends are a great pick too. They have strong, tough qualities and help lower the environmental impact. Think of a backpack made with these fabrics; it holds up well with daily use while keeping a stylish look.
Materials like Piñatex, made from pineapple leaves, add another eco-friendly option. They work much like normal synthetics in tough tests, giving you solid durability along with a greener edge.
Eco-friendly finishes are also worth noting. They meet strict standards for colorfastness without using chemicals that weaken performance. This blend of smart design and strong build helps keep your accessories looking great for a long time.
